全球色母粒市场预计将从 2025 年的 79.8 亿美元成长到 2031 年的 118.5 亿美元,复合年增长率为 6.81%。

色母粒,技术上称为母粒,是由高浓度颜料或添加剂分散在相容的载体树脂中製成的精密配方,用于在生产过程中为原材料聚合物着色。市场的主要驱动力是消费品包装领域日益增长的品牌差异化需求,以及汽车和建设产业对美观且耐用​​材料的强劲需求。这些产业越来越依赖色母粒来实现特定的功能特性和视觉吸引力,同时又不影响材料的性能。

根据欧洲母粒混配商协会 (EuMBC) 2025 年的一项调查,相关人员预测,未来一个财政年度母粒产业的成长率将在 0% 至 5% 之间。儘管前景乐观,但由于有关彩色塑胶可回收性的严格环境法规,市场扩张仍面临许多障碍。尤其具有挑战性的是,近红外线分选系统在处理传统炭黑颜料时遇到的技术难题,迫使製造商进行成本高昂的配方调整以确保合规。

市场驱动因素

软包装和硬包装领域需求的激增是色料市场的主要驱动力。这主要得益于快速发展的电子商务环境以及对视觉品牌差异化的需求。随着消费品製造商努力提升货架陈列效果并确保产品保护,薄膜、瓶子和容器用色母粒的母粒正在飙升。包装产业的强劲表现印证了这一趋势。根据美国软包装协会2024年8月发布的《美国软包装产业现况报告》,预计2023年,美国软包装产业的年销售额将达到429亿美元。如此庞大的市场规模凸显了色料配方在将原材料聚合物转化为满足不断变化的物流和美学需求的、具有吸引力的、适销对路的消费品方面所发挥的关键作用。

同时,永续和生物基配方的加速普及正在重塑产业格局,迫使製造商开发与再生材料相容的先进浓缩物。这项转变主要受循环经济目标的驱动,因此必须将消费后树脂(PCR)融入新产品中。通常需要使用专用着色剂来弥补再生材料固有的泛黄和外观差异。例如,根据美国国家PET回收协会于2024年12月发布的《2023年PET回收报告》,2023年美国宝特瓶消费后再生PET的平均含量达到了创纪录的16.2%。需要这种永续着色的基材规模仍然巨大。根据欧洲塑胶协会(Plastics Europe)预测,2024年欧洲塑胶总产量预计将稳定在5,400万吨,这意味着大量的聚合物生产需要日益复杂且环保的着色解决方案。

市场挑战

针对彩色塑胶可回收性的严格监管环境,特别是炭黑颜料与分类基础设施的技术不相容性,对全球彩色化合物市场的成长构成了重大障碍。标准炭黑会吸收近红外光(NIR),因此无法被现代回收必不可少的光学分类系统检测到。这迫使製造商重新配製产品,使用近红外线可检测的颜料,而这些颜料高成本,且技术整合更困难。这种强制性转换抑制了产能扩张和创新方面的资本投资,造成生产效率瓶颈,并挤压了整个价值链的利润空间。

这些监管压力带来的经济影响在近期行业绩效指标中清晰可见,反映整体经济放缓,直接影响上游供应商。根据欧洲塑胶协会(Plastics Europe)预测,2024年欧洲塑胶产业销售额将降至3,980亿欧元,大幅萎缩,主要原因是生产成本上升和监管限制。这项放缓凸显了满足严格的循环经济标准所带来的财务负担如何直接阻碍市场发展,并降低整个产业的竞争力。

市场趋势

在汽车和消费性电子产业对高价值产品差异化的需求推动下,特效颜料和感官颜料的广泛应用正成为一大趋势。与标准包装着色剂不同,这些先进的配方技术利用珠光、金属和感温变色添加剂来创造动态的视觉质感,从而提升品牌认知度和产品感知品质。这种向复杂美学解决方案的转变体现在汽车行业的消费者偏好上,他们越来越倾向于选择精緻的金属涂层而非纯色涂料。根据BASF于2025年1月发布的《2024年BASF报告》,灰色调因其微妙的金属效果而呈现出强烈的表面动态感,将占据汽车色彩市场约20%的份额。这反映出汽车产业对特效颜料的依赖性日益增强。

同时,数位配色技术的整合正在透过简化配方流程和减少对实体样品的依赖,改变生产环境。这一趋势的特点是采用基于云端的软体和人工智慧驱动的光强度,使生产商能够实现精准的颜色一致性,并显着缩短全球供应链的前置作业时间。各大特种化学品集团为实现技术基础设施现代化而进行的大量资本投资,充分体现了产业对数位转型的投入。根据 Altana AG 于 2025 年 3 月发布的《2024 年企业报告》,该公司计划将工厂设施、数位化和永续性的投资增加 30%,达到 1.8 亿欧元,并强调实施先进的数位工具以优化生产效率是其战略重点。

The Global Colour Concentrates Market is projected to expand from USD 7.98 Billion in 2025 to USD 11.85 Billion by 2031, registering a CAGR of 6.81 percent. Technically known as masterbatches, colour concentrates are precise formulations comprising high concentrations of pigments or additives dispersed within a compatible carrier resin, used to colour raw polymers during manufacturing. The market is fundamentally anchored by the intensifying need for brand differentiation within the consumer packaging sector, alongside substantial demand for aesthetically consistent and durable materials in the automotive and construction industries. These sectors increasingly depend on concentrates to attain specific functional properties and visual appeal without compromising material performance.

According to the European Masterbatchers and Compounders (EuMBC), a 2025 survey of industry stakeholders forecasted a growth range of 0 to 5 percent for the masterbatch sector over the subsequent year. Despite this positive outlook, market expansion faces a significant impediment due to stringent environmental regulations regarding the recyclability of colored plastics. A specific challenge involves the technical difficulties near-infrared sorting systems encounter with conventional carbon black pigments, compelling manufacturers to undertake costly reformulations to ensure compliance.

Market Driver

The escalating demand within the flexible and rigid packaging sectors serves as a primary catalyst for the colour concentrates market, fueled by the booming e-commerce landscape and the necessity for visual brand differentiation. As consumer goods manufacturers strive to enhance shelf appeal and ensure product protection, the consumption of masterbatches for films, bottles, and containers has surged. This trend is specifically quantified by the robust performance of the packaging sector; according to the Flexible Packaging Association's August 2024 'State of the U.S. Flexible Packaging Industry Report', the U.S. flexible packaging industry generated an estimated $42.9 billion in annual sales for 2023. Such significant market value underscores the critical role of colour formulations in converting raw polymers into attractive, marketable consumer goods that meet evolving logistical and aesthetic requirements.

Simultaneously, the industry is being reshaped by the accelerated adoption of sustainable and bio-based formulations, compelling manufacturers to develop advanced concentrates compatible with recycled materials. This shift is largely driven by circular economy goals which necessitate the integration of post-consumer resin (PCR) into new products, often requiring specialized colorants to correct the yellowing or aesthetic inconsistencies inherent in recycled feedstocks. For instance, according to the National Association for PET Container Resources in the '2023 PET Recycling Report' released in December 2024, the average post-consumer recycled PET content in U.S. bottles reached an all-time high of 16.2 percent in 2023. The scale of the substrate material requiring such sustainable coloration remains vast; according to Plastics Europe, in 2024, total European plastics production stabilized at 54 million tonnes in 2023, highlighting the substantial volume of polymer output that now demands increasingly complex and eco-friendly colour solutions.

Market Challenge

The stringent regulatory landscape focusing on the recyclability of colored plastics, particularly the technical incompatibility of carbon black pigments with sorting infrastructure, stands as a formidable barrier to the growth of the Global Colour Concentrates Market. Standard carbon black absorbs near-infrared (NIR) radiation, making it undetectable to the optical sorting systems essential for modern recycling. Consequently, manufacturers are forced to reformulate products using NIR-detectable pigments, which are significantly costlier and technically demanding to integrate. This compulsory shift diverts capital away from capacity expansion and innovation, creating a bottleneck in production efficiency while compressing profit margins across the value chain.

The economic impact of these compliance-driven pressures is evident in recent industrial performance metrics, reflecting a broader slowdown that directly affects upstream suppliers. According to Plastics Europe, in 2024, the turnover for the European plastics industry declined to €398 billion, representing a sharp contraction attributed to rising manufacturing costs and regulatory constraints. This downturn illustrates how the financial strain of meeting strict circular economy standards is directly hampering market development and reducing the overall competitiveness of the sector.

Market Trends

The proliferation of special effect and sensory pigments is emerging as a dominant trend, driven by the need for high-value product differentiation in the automotive and consumer electronics sectors. Unlike standard colorations used in packaging, these advanced formulations utilize pearlescent, metallic, and thermochromic additives to create dynamic visual textures that enhance brand perception and perceived product quality. This shift toward complex aesthetic solutions is quantified by consumer preferences in the automotive space, where sophisticated metallic finishes are increasingly favored over solid colors. According to BASF, January 2025, in the 'BASF Color Report 2024', gray tones, which are predominantly characterized by fine metallic effects that provide strong surface dynamism, captured nearly 20 percent of the total automotive color market, reflecting the growing industrial reliance on effect-based pigments.

Simultaneously, the integration of digital color matching technologies is reshaping the manufacturing landscape by streamlining the formulation process and reducing dependency on physical sampling. This trend is characterized by the adoption of cloud-based software and AI-driven spectrophotometry, which allow producers to achieve precise color consistency and drastically cut lead times across global supply chains. The industry's commitment to this digital transformation is evident in the substantial capital allocation by major specialty chemical groups toward modernizing their technological infrastructure. According to Altana AG, March 2025, in the 'Corporate Report 2024', the company increased its investment in sites, digitalization, and sustainability by 30 percent to 180 million euros, underscoring the strategic priority placed on implementing advanced digital tools to optimize production efficiency.
